Who issues the permits necessary for shooting on major city streets or highways?

Explanation:
When filming on major city streets or highways, the authority that grants permission is the city’s film office, typically coordinated by a film officer. This office is specialized to review shoots, approve road closures or partial street use, coordinate with police and public works, verify insurance and safety plans, and issue the official permit that allows the production to proceed. The police department may help with traffic control and safety during the shoot, but they don’t issue the permit themselves. The mayor’s office and the city council set policy and budgets, not the day-to-day approval of filming on public streets.
